It’s good to get these things on record again once in awhile. 85 Republicans in the Kansas Assembly hate poor people so much that they voted once again not to expand Medicaid to cover 160,000 of them at federal expense. Their lame excuse: they might not have enough votes to back out of the program, on the off chance that the feds stop paying for it. Given 37 votes currently for expansion in a 125 person house, the Democrats would need to pick up 26 seats in the Fall to pass it.
